.DISCUSSION...Cool and wet conditions will continue into this
weekend as another system passes over the region. Temperatures
will remain cool to mild with dry conditions developing as
northerly flow develops aloft. Higher elevation valleys will
susceptible to morning freezes early next week. Precipitation
chances will return across the area in the latter half of next
week. Locally breezy winds will develop through the weekend, with
light winds to persist at least through the middle of next week.


***Winds are 20 foot 10 minute averages***
***CWR-chance of wetting rain 0.10 or greater***
***Ventilation Index is derived from the
   transport wind multiplied by the mixing
   height in 100`s of feet. Index categories
   are a generalized indicator and users are
   encourage to develop criteria that are
   suitable and representative of dispersion
   conditions in their local area of interest.***
     Note: Max transport winds may not occur
     at the same time as max mixing height.
